Replaced the CCFL tube backlight on my ThinkPad T41 with a modern LED replacement from AliExpress.
The results are outstanding, it's about as bright as my modern laptop (~600nits?).
Installation was very hard (took about 4 hours) and dimming doesn't work anymore.
Capturing such differences in pictures is pretty hard, but I think especially the difference in color vibrancy is pretty obvious from the pictures.
Only recommended for experts, I was sweating blood by the end:

Warning: There’s an app for blurring out sensitive information in images called Obfuscate being featured on #GNOME Software right now.
Please be careful.
The default blur setting can easily be reversed.
The default should be to replace the areas with a solid colour or a pattern not derived from the underlying information.
This really should not be a featured app in its current state.
